Concrete Stain

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Chemical stains applied to new, old or remodeled concrete or construction is called as concrete stain. Containing metallic salts which react with the concrete and becoming a permanent part of the concrete, concrete stain is also known as acid stain. Black, brown and blue-green are the color groups that are manufactured by most concrete stain manufacturing companies.

Concrete Pipe

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Being a long lasting and structurally strong material, a concrete pipe is generally used to conduct water supply or serve as drains in both rural and urban areas. Most concrete pipe water supply as well as drainage and sewer systems that have been constructed in the earlier century still stand strong and function as efficiently as when they had first been constructed.

Concrete Pump

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Pumping is an efficient way of placing concrete while constructing buildings. This method is very economical and practical. This method of placing concrete proves to be very helpful while constructing high-rise buildings or while placing large slabs where the concrete truck cannot reach the concrete.

Concrete Sealers

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Concrete sealers are used to seal gaps and leaks on concrete pavements, driveways, patios or even concrete counter tops in the kitchen. Made from synthetic epoxy resins, these sealers seal the gaps and probable leak areas and make the surface water-resistant and prevent water from penetrating into the concrete.

Concrete Mixer

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

A concrete mixer, as the name suggests is a device that mixes cement with water and other additives such as sand and gravel. Ranging from large commercial concrete mixer trucks to portable mini mixers, this powered device normally consists of a motor, a rotating drum and a chute.

Concrete Angle

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Concrete panels or large concrete surfaces may require support in the form of concrete angles. When the entire structure is made of concrete, using angles made from other materials may not be a designer’s choice of work. Concrete angles are made from steel reinforced precast concrete with added additives for providing the extra strength and durability required.

Blacktop Concrete

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Blacktop is a combination of gravel, sand and asphalt while concrete is a mixture of cement, gravel and sand. Although both are entirely different products, they may be used together in layers in big construction projects.

Concrete Cleaning

Thursday, August 31st, 2006

Many concrete surfaces accumulate dirt very slowly so it is difficult to notice the change in appearance. But when a concrete surface is cleaned, it is surprising how much better it looks. Scheduled periodic cleaning can avoid the gradual accumulation of dirt on concrete. The most effective way to clean concrete without damaging its surface is power-washing.
